Only 3 to 4 minutes per pound and not greasy at all - all the juices are locked in. Take it out, let it rest on the cutting board for ten to fifteen minutes with a tea towel over it, take off the leg first, carve out one side of the breast and slice from the board. Serve and while your guests are starting to eat, carve off and slice the other side.
